Output 23ff99ea4f37910c065eec67be76134598a1c4e013b731fb9ef9454c246c2045:2

value
34138453
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0032dfec82583204a116cca84ab53349f65e30c3 OP_EQUAL
address
31i4sNzmtjzvf7KFvFrxd6DYvG8vKSu4jA
transaction
23ff99ea4f37910c065eec67be76134598a1c4e013b731fb9ef9454c246c2045
spent
true